Overview
Beat the crowds to Tulum's spectacular waterfront archaeological site then enjoy a leisurely jungle adventure at Tankah Park on this intimate tour, with numbers capped at just 10 travelers and transfers direct from your hotel. Swim in a cenote, ride a zipline, try your hand at canoeing and snorkeling, and enjoy a jungle trail. There's time to savor a delicious Mayan lunch before returning to base.
- Visit the Tulum archaeological site then spend the day at Tankah Park
- Try canoeing and snorkeling, and fly through the air on a zipline
- Numbers are limited to 10, for a more intimate feel than the big-bus tours
- Stay fueled with a traditional Mayan lunch plus snacks and bottled water
